بیت کوین ارز دیجیتال مهم و محبوب دنیای کریپتو کارنسی است. با توجه به ارز بالای این ارز توسعه دهندگان همواره به دنبال ارائه راههایی برای افزایش امنیت آن هستند. در این رابطه یکی از مفاهیم و یا به عبارتی ابزارهای کاربردی که شاید شماهم با آن آشنا باشید بیت کوین کور است. همان طور که از اسم آن مشخص است، این ابزار کاملا مربوط به ارز دیجیتال بیت کوین هست و از آن میتوان به عنوان یک کیف پول ایمن برای نگهداری بیت کوین استفاده کرد.
به نوعی برخی از کاربران Bitcoin Core را به عنوان هسته اصلی شبکه بیت کوین میدانند. دلیلش هم این است که بیشتر فرآیندهایی که در شبکه بیت کوین انجام میشود به وسیله بیت کوین کور مدیریت میشود!
اگر شما هم برای اولین بار است که با این عنوان مواجه میشوید و میخواهید در رابطه با آن اطلاعات بیشتری کسب کنید، در ادامه همراه ما باشید تا این موضوع را به صورت ساده و قابل فهم بیان کنیم.
بیت کوین کور چیست؟
به وسیله اتصال تعداد زیادی نود و گره (Node) شبکه بیت کوین از پروتکلهای BTC پیروی میکند، سپس اجرا آن را انجام میدهد. تنها محصولی که همچنان با اصول اولیه بیت کوین انتشار مییابد، ارز دیجیتال بیت کوین کور است. همچنین آن دسته از نرمافزارهایی که با این رمزارز به صورت کامل در ارتباط هستند، پیوسته تغییر و به روزرسانی میشوند. یکی از افراد توسعه دهنده نرمافزار Bitcoin core، گوین اندرسن (Gavin Andersen) نام دارد. او معتقد است به دلیل اینکه بستر این نرمافزار بیت کوین است، باید همه افراد آن را به عنوان هسته بیت کوین بشناسند. این نرمافزار منبع باز، که به وسیله full-node به وجود آمده است میتواند تایید بلاک چین را به صورت کامل انجام دهد. نرمافزار متن باز open-source، به این معنی است، که هر فردی میتواند کدهای آن را مشاهده کند و تغییراتی در آن به وجود آورد.
بیت کوین کور (Bitcoin core) یک نرمافزار است که شبکه بیت کوین را اجرا میکند. این نرمافزار علاوه بر مدیریت شبکه btc دارای یک کیف پول دیجیتال نیز هست که امکان دریافت، ارسال و ذخیرهسازی ارز دیجیتال بیت کوین را برای کاربران این صنعت امکانپذیر کرده است. نقش اصلی که شبکه بیت کوین دارد، کمک کردن به کاربران برای تشخیص بلاک چین اصلی از دیگر بلاکها است.
این نرمافزار فعالیت خود را با نام Bitcoin-Qt آغاز کرد و به دست ولادمیر فن در لان توسط کدنویسیهای ساتوشی ناکاماتو نوشته شد. در واقع به کمک آن شما میتوانید از خدمات پرداختی که روی شبکه بیت کوین قابل انجام است ستفاده کنید.
نحوه تشکیل بیت کوین کور
یک کلاینت که روی شبکه بیت کوین اجرا شده است، بیت کوین کور نامیده میشود. Bitcoin core در سال ۲۰۰۸ تقریبا ۱ سال قبل از انتشار رمزارز بیت کوین به وسیله ساتوشی ناکاموتو و یک تیم پر قدرت تشکیل شد. تا سال ۲۰۱۰ خود ساتوشی ناکاموتو از Bitcoin core نگهداری میکرد و بعد از غیبت او اعضای تیمش، فعالیتهای راه اندازی و توسعه را بر عهده گرفتند.
نکته مهمی که باید بدانید این است که بیت کوین کور در حال حاضر به یک بخش جدایی ناپذیر از شبکه اصلی بیت کوین است و هدف از ایجاد آن درک و شناخت بیشتر کاربران از بلاکهای معتبر است. در کنار این هدف مهم شما میتوانید از bitcoin core به عنوان یک کیف پول ایمن نیز استفاده کنید و بیت کوینهای خود را در آن ذخیره کنید.
-
مدیریت بیت کوین کور با چه کسانی است؟
تا این قسمت دانستیم که بیت کوین کور یک نرمافزار متن باز است. اما این ویژگی موجب نمیشود تا هر نوع پیشنهادی درباره کدهای گوناگون، تمام ساختار Bitcoin core را تغییر دهد. هرچند افرادی که جامعه فعال این نرمافزار را تشکیل داده اند، همراه با فعالیت بالا و قدرت زیاد، بررسی و تحلیل کدهای پیشنهاد شده را انجام میدهند. آنها میتوانند به راحتی وارد پیشنهادات و بحثها شده و همراه با رای دادن، روی تصمیمات تاثیرات چشم گیری بگذارند.
در کل یک پیشنهاد به وسیله جامعه Bitcoin core مورد قبول واقع میگردد. سپس توسط افرادی که نگهدارنده کد (maintainers of the code) هستند، اعمال میشود. این اشخاص، که جامعه فعال بیت کوین کور آنها را قبول دارند، موظفند تا از اجرای کدهای تایید نشده به صورت خودکار و بررسی نشده جلوگیری کند.
اگر که محافظین قابل اطمینان، به درستی از کدها نگهداری نکنند، هیچ ایرادی در سیستم کار بیت کوین کور ایجاد نمیگردد. در صورت رخ دادن این رویداد، خیلی ساده میتوان کد قیمت بیت کوین کور را با چشم پوشی از تغییرات مخرب، بازیابی کرد. پس متوجه میشویم، که نفوذ و قدرت این مجموعه به هیچ وجه زیاد نیست.
بیت کوین کور چه ویژگی هایی دارد؟
بیتکوین کور (Bitcoin Core) نرمافزار مرجع برای پیادهسازی و اجرای نودهای کامل در شبکه بیتکوین است. این نرمافزار دارای ویژگیها و خصوصیات زیر است:
پیادهسازی پروتکل بیتکوین:
بیتکوین کور به عنوان نرمافزار اصلی برای اجرای پروتکل بیتکوین استفاده میشود و اجازه میدهد تا کاربران به عنوان نودهای کامل در شبکه فعالیت کنند.
تأیید تراکنشها و تولید بلاک:
این نرمافزار به نودها اجازه میدهد تا تراکنشها را تأیید و بلاکهای جدید را ایجاد کنند که به ثبت تراکنشها در بلاکچین کمک میکند.
امنیت و انعطافپذیری:
بیتکوین کور بهروزرسانیهای دورهای را ارائه میدهد تا امنیت و انعطافپذیری شبکه را حفظ کند.
منبع باز:
کد منبع بیتکوین کور به صورت باز (open-source) در دسترس است. این به افراد امکان میدهد که کد را بررسی کرده و بهبودها یا تغییرات را ارائه دهند.
سازگاری با تغییرات شبکه:
بیتکوین کور سازگاری با تغییرات پروتکل بیتکوین را فراهم میکند و تغییرات و بهبودهای ارائه شده در شبکه را پذیرفته و اجرا میکند.
پشتیبانی از نودهای ماینینگ:
این نرمافزار به افرادی که ماینینگ انجام میدهند کمک میکند تا بلوکهای جدید را تولید کرده و شبکه را حفظ کنند.
توسعهپذیری:
بیتکوین کور به توسعهدهندگان امکان میدهد تا برنامهها و سرویسهای مبتنی بر بیتکوین را توسعه دهند و از این اکوسیستم بهرهمند شوند.
کاربرد و اهداف بیت کوین کور
در زمان اجرا شدن کد، بیت کوین کور، افراد معاملهگر یا کاربر درون شبکه بیت کوین نقش یک گره را انجام میدهند. سپس، افراد به بلاکهای جدید به صورت استقلال یافته اعتبار بخشیده و دیگر تراکنشها از سمت کاربران دیگر تایید میگردند. این رویداد، با در کنترل قرار دادن ماینرها در آخر موجب میشوند، کاربران به شخص سوم احتیاجی پیدا نکنند.
در ضمن یک کیف پول دیجیتال با نرمافزار در این نرمافزار قرار داده شده است تا کاربران به صورت مستقیم بتوانند در نرمافزار فعالیت کنند. بعلاوه با بیت کوین کور میتوانید کیف پولهای گوناگون را به شبکههای بیت کوین متصل کنید و تراکنشهای دریافتی را تایید کنید. شما در هنگامی که دانلود تمام شد میتوانید از آن به عنوان کیف پول خود بهره ببرید و اگر مایل به کمک یا حمایت از شبکه هستید از روش تبدیل کردن به نود میتوانید این کار را انجام دهید.
استخراج با بیت کوین کور
در استخراج بیت کوین امکان استفاده از بیت کوین کور وجود دارد. این فعالیت در کنار اینکه بسیار سود به همراه دارد، مقدار زیادی انرژی و زمان نیز مصرف میکند. مراحل استخراج Bitcoin core به صورت زیر انجام میگردد:
- باید والت را داخل نرمافزار بیت کوین کور باز کنید.
- بعد از اینکه روی گزینه Debug Windows کلیک کردید، تب Console را انتخاب کنید.
- برای اینکه استخراج را آغاز کنید باید عبارت Setgenerate را تایپ کنید.
- سپس زمانی که قصد توقف استخراج را دارید، باید Setgenerate false را تایپ کنید.
قبل از هر کاری از قدرت سیستم کامپیوتر خود اطمینان کسب کنید؛ چراکه محاسبات سنگین هستند. در گذشته با کامپیوترهای خانگی این کار ممکن بود، ولی با گذشت زمان همراه با بیشتر شدن استخراج این رمزارز، به سیستمهای قویتری نیاز پیدا کرده است. بعد از این جریان، نگرانیهای در رابطه با آسیبهایی که دستگاههای ماینر به محیط زیست وارد میکنند، به وجود آمد.
بیشتر بخوانید: درآمد ماینر چقدر است؟ آموزش محاسبه هزینه ماینینگ
امنیت در بیت کوین کور چگونه است؟
به طور کلی میتوان گفت که این سیستم و کیف پول Bitcoin core، به مقدار امنیت کامپیوتری که از آن برای اجرا کردن نرمافزار بهره میبرند، امنیت دارند. با وجود اینکه شما فقط یک آدرس را به کیف پول خود اتصال میدهید، اما باید از تمامی اقداماتی که برای حفاظت در برابر حملههای سایبری و هک به وسیله کامپیوتر خود ایجاد میگردد، مطمعن باشید.
با توجه به وب سایت بیت کوین، کاربران باید از کلیدهای خصوصی و عمومی خود یک نسخه پشتیبانی به وجود آورند تا امنیت کیف پول خود را ایجاد کنند و در کنار برای ذخیرهی مبلغهای بیشتر، از کیف پولهای آفلاین استفاده کنند. همیشه مراقب اعلانهای مربوط به روزرسانی یا امنیتی باشند و اجازه دسترسی افراد وارث را به بیت کوین خود در صورت فوت یا ناتوانی، بدهند. به طور کلی، میزان امنیت و حفظ حریم خصوصی دادههای کاربران، به مسئولیت و توجه خودشان همراه حداقل مشخصات سیستم مورد استفاده بستگی دارد.
مزایا و معایب استفاده از بیت کوین کور چیست؟
مزایای نرمافزار Bitcoin core
اگر بخواهیم به طور کلی مزیتهای بیت کوین کور را عنوان کنیم، میتوان به امنیت بالا، متن باز بودن و یک تیم پشتیبانی خیلی قوی اشاره کرد.
- با توجه به این که بیت کوین کور نرم افزاری متن باز (Open Source) است، یعنی کاربران میتوانند همراه با استفاده از تحلیل هایشان، کمک کنند تا نرمافزار پیشرفت کند و همینطور تغییراتی در آن به وجود میآورند. در اصل چون بیت کوین کور متن باز است، میتواند باز تولید انجام دهد. سپس در هنگامی که هر کدام از افراد توسعهگر یا کاربر بتوانند کدها را بررسی کنند، و ایرادات را از بین ببرند، از کلاهبرداری نبودن نرمافزار اطمینان حاصل کنند.
- بهترین و امنترین نود در بیت کوین، بیت کوین کور است. این رویداد این معنی را میدهد که هر دو نرمافزار گره به صورت کامل در بیت کوین کور، برای افزایش اعتبار تمام بلاک چینهای این رمزارز به کار میرود. به همین دلیل، افراد به عنوان کاربر میتوانند نقش یک گره را داخل شبکه به وسیله اجرای بیت کوین کور، شکل دهند. سپس به شکل مستقل این توانایی را دارند، تایید تراکنشها همراه با اعتبار بلوکههای دریافتی را به وسیله دیگر افراد کاربر انجام دهند.
- تیم پشتیبانی بسیار قویی که Bitcoin core دارد، به صورت شبانه روزی و دائم در حال فعالیت است و در هر لحظه از شب یا روز امکان دسترسی و صحبت با این تیم توسط کاربران و حل مشکلات شما، امکانپذیر است.
معایب نرمافزار Bitcoin core
همانطور که نرمافزار بیت کوین کور ویژگی و مزایای بسیار عالی دارد، اما همیشه هر ابزار کاربردی پر سود، میزانی ایراد به همراه دارد. که دانستن آنها بسیار کاربرد دارد.
- یکی از علتهای ضعف این نرم افزار، تک مرحلهای بودن آن است و اینکه دیگر گزینهای برای بیشتر کردن امنیت وجود ندارد.
- همانطور که اشاره شد، بیت کوین کور یک نود کامل میباشد. در نتیجه، میتواند شبکه Blockchain را به صورت کامل روی کامپیوتر شما دانلود کند.
- مقدار حجم این شبکه حدود ۲۰۰ مگابایت است و روز به روز مقدارش بیشتر میگردد.
- با توجه به ارتباطی که بین بیت کوین کور با تمامی شبکههای بیت کوین وجود دارد، حدودا مقدار زمانی که نیاز دارد تا با شبکه BTC به هماهنگی برسد یک هفته است. سپس امکان استفادهی شما ایجاد میگردد.
- شما نمیتوانید از بیت کوین کور برای ذخیره چندین رمزارز استفاده کنید چراکه تنها ذخیره ارز دیجیتال بیت کوین با این نرمافزار امکانپذیر است.
- همچنین، این نرمافزار پشتیبانی از فورکهای رمزارز بیت کوین مانند بیت کوین کش و بیت کوین گلد را انجام نمیدهد.
نحوه دانلود نرم افزار بیت کوین کور
برای اینکه نرمافزار بیت کوین کور را دانلود ، باید به لینک ( https://bitcoin.org/en/download) در سایت اصلی بیت کوین مراجعه کنید سپس مراحل ذیل را طی کنید.
-
مرحله اول
روی Download Bitcoin Core کلیک کنید و برنامه ای که مطابق سیستم تان است را دانلود کنید.
-
مرحله دوم
بعد از دانلود و پایان نصب، برای اجرای آن میتوانید دبل کلیک را روی ایکون بیت کوین کور انجام دهید. سپس، نوبت تایید ویندوزهای شما برای اجرا میگردد. با انتخاب گزینه Yes برنامه اجرا میگردد. نصب کنندههای Bitcoin core مثل دیگر نصب کنندهها افراد را برای طی کردن مراحل راهنمایی میکنند.
-
مرحله سوم
به همین ترتیب فرایند را ادامه دهید. سپس از شما درخواست میگردد تا ذخیره شبکه بلاک چین بیت کوین همراه با کیف پول خود را انجام دهید. بعد در صورت اختصاص دادن یک شبکه مخصوص و یا هارد درایوی دادهها را به محل مد نظر وارد کنید. به جز این میتوانید با کلیک روی OK در قسمت پیش فرض اطلاعات را نگهداری کنید. احتمال دارد، در این قسمت اتصال به وسیله فایروال خودتان بلاک شود. شما همراه با کلیک روی Allow Access از اتصال خود به رمزارز بیت کوین اطمینان کامل دریافت کنید.
-
مرحله چهارم
این مرحله با دانلود بلاکچین بیت کوین با رابط گرافیکی Bitcoin core آغاز میگردد. توجه کنید که فرآیند این دانلود میتواند چندین روز زمان ببرد و در شرایطی که اینترنت ضعیف باشد، کمی زمان صرف افزایش مییابد. در هنگام دانلود، بیت کوین کور قسمت اعظمی از عرض باند شما را تصرف میکند. شما در هر لحظه که بخواهید میتوانید این نرمافزار را ببندید یا باز کنید و یا به طور کامل فرایند را متوقف کنید. زمانی که برای بار بعدی برنامه اجرا شد، دانلود درست از همان نقطه که توقف یافته، شروع میگردد.
نتیجه گیری
در این مقاله از صرافی فراچنج بیت کوین کور را برایتان تحلیل و بررسی کردیم. همانطور که گفتیم، بیت کوین کور یک نرمافزار است. این نرمافزار که فقط به BTC اختصاص یافته، موجب دریافت این ارز دیجیتال با ارزش میگردد. Bitcoin core به یک هسته که در وسط بیت کوین قرار دارد، تشبیه شده و به وسیله ساتوشی ناکاموتو تاسیس شد. به طور کلی اگر بخواهیم یک نتیجه گیری درباره این نرمافزار ارائه دهیم باید گفت بهترین راههای استخراج بیت کوین استفاده از بیت کوین کور است. امروزه به دلیل حجم حدود ۴۰۰ گیگا بایتی این نرمافزار که بسیار بالا است، کسی از این نرمافزار در جهت انتقال یا ذخیره بیت کوین استفاده نمیکند. در نتیجه بیت کوین کور دیگر کاربرد به صرفهای ندارد.
نظرات کاربران